Remote Access Service Fails If Plug and Play Service Is Disabled

SYMPTOMS

When you try to detect a modem in the Remote Access Service (RAS) setup, Windows NT queries the modem but returns the following error message:
Windows NT did not find any modems attached to your computer.
If you try to start the Remote Access Connection Manager service or Dial-up Networking, the following error message appears:
Cannot load the Remote Access Connection Manager service.
Error 711: RasMan initialization failure. Check the event log.
In the event log you will see:
Event 7024 Service Control Manager
The Remote Access Connection Manager service terminated with server-specific error 620.
If you try to open the Modem Control Panel, the application fails to open.

CAUSE

The Plug and Play service is stopped or disabled.

RESOLUTION

1.Go into Control Panel and click Services.
2.Start the Plug and Play service, and change the Startup mode from Manual or Disabled to Enabled.

APPLIES TO
Microsoft Windows NT Workstation 4.0 Developer Edition
Microsoft Windows NT Server 4.0 Standard Edition
